- 
    Bug 
- 
    Resolution: Duplicate
- 
     P2 P2
- 
    10, 11, 12
                    Test: compiler/aot/cli/MultipleAOTLibraryTest.java
Exception in thread "main" java.lang.AssertionError: duplicate classes for name Ljava/io/PrintStream;
at jdk.aot/jdk.tools.jaotc.AOTCompiledClass.getAOTKlassData(AOTCompiledClass.java:341)
at jdk.aot/jdk.tools.jaotc.AOTCompiledClass.addFingerprintKlassData(AOTCompiledClass.java:371)
at jdk.aot/jdk.tools.jaotc.CompiledMethodInfo.addDependentKlassData(CompiledMethodInfo.java:293)
at jdk.aot/jdk.tools.jaotc.InfopointProcessor.recordScopeKlasses(InfopointProcessor.java:89)
at jdk.aot/jdk.tools.jaotc.InfopointProcessor.recordScopeKlasses(InfopointProcessor.java:84)
at jdk.aot/jdk.tools.jaotc.InfopointProcessor.process(InfopointProcessor.java:78)
at jdk.aot/jdk.tools.jaotc.MetadataBuilder.processInfopointsAndMarks(MetadataBuilder.java:222)
at jdk.aot/jdk.tools.jaotc.MetadataBuilder.processMetadataClass(MetadataBuilder.java:69)
at jdk.aot/jdk.tools.jaotc.MetadataBuilder.processMetadata(MetadataBuilder.java:63)
at jdk.aot/jdk.tools.jaotc.DataBuilder.prepareData(DataBuilder.java:161)
at jdk.aot/jdk.tools.jaotc.Main.run(Main.java:188)
at jdk.aot/jdk.tools.jaotc.Main.run(Main.java:101)
at jdk.aot/jdk.tools.jaotc.Main.main(Main.java:80)
            
Exception in thread "main" java.lang.AssertionError: duplicate classes for name Ljava/io/PrintStream;
at jdk.aot/jdk.tools.jaotc.AOTCompiledClass.getAOTKlassData(AOTCompiledClass.java:341)
at jdk.aot/jdk.tools.jaotc.AOTCompiledClass.addFingerprintKlassData(AOTCompiledClass.java:371)
at jdk.aot/jdk.tools.jaotc.CompiledMethodInfo.addDependentKlassData(CompiledMethodInfo.java:293)
at jdk.aot/jdk.tools.jaotc.InfopointProcessor.recordScopeKlasses(InfopointProcessor.java:89)
at jdk.aot/jdk.tools.jaotc.InfopointProcessor.recordScopeKlasses(InfopointProcessor.java:84)
at jdk.aot/jdk.tools.jaotc.InfopointProcessor.process(InfopointProcessor.java:78)
at jdk.aot/jdk.tools.jaotc.MetadataBuilder.processInfopointsAndMarks(MetadataBuilder.java:222)
at jdk.aot/jdk.tools.jaotc.MetadataBuilder.processMetadataClass(MetadataBuilder.java:69)
at jdk.aot/jdk.tools.jaotc.MetadataBuilder.processMetadata(MetadataBuilder.java:63)
at jdk.aot/jdk.tools.jaotc.DataBuilder.prepareData(DataBuilder.java:161)
at jdk.aot/jdk.tools.jaotc.Main.run(Main.java:188)
at jdk.aot/jdk.tools.jaotc.Main.run(Main.java:101)
at jdk.aot/jdk.tools.jaotc.Main.main(Main.java:80)
- duplicates
- 
                    JDK-8215224 Update Graal -           
- Resolved
 
-         
- 
                    JDK-8203835 Test AotInvokeInterface2AotTest.java failed with duplicate classes for name Lcompiler/calls/common/CallsBase; -           
- Closed
 
-         
- relates to
- 
                    JDK-8173227 [JVMCI] HotSpotJVMCIMetaAccessContext.fromClass is inefficient -           
- Resolved
 
-         
- 
                    JDK-8283420 [AOT] Exclude TrackedFlagTest/NotTrackedFlagTest in 11u because of intermittent java.lang.AssertionError: duplicate classes for name Ljava/lang/Boolean; -           
- Resolved
 
-